Narrative:Boeing B-29-55-BA Superfortress 44-84028: Built under licence by Bell Aircraft Company, Marietta, Atlanta, Georgia. Delivered to the USAAF 10 July 1945. Assigned to 462nd Bomb Squadron, 346th Bomb Group, Kadena Field, Okinawa. Re-Assigned to 39th Bomb Group. Assigned to 327th Bomb Squadron, 92nd Bomb Group, Spokane AFB, Washington
Written off (destroyed) August 30, 1949: The crew was conducting a training sortie from Fairchild AFB, Spokane, Washington. En route, an engine failed, forcing the crew to abandon the aircraft and to bail out. Out of control, the heavy bomber crashed in a uninhabited area located 4 miles north of Wellpinit, Stevens County, Washington (at approximate Coordinates: 47°53′17″N 117°59′17″W). The co-pilot was killed while 13 other occupants were evacuated safely
